오늘은 모든 것에 관한 것입니다 AI 기반 테스트 자동화 생각하고, 배우고, 적응합니다. 💡
귀하가 QA 엔지니어, DevOps 전문가 또는 기술 책임자이든, AI 테스트 도구 핵심입니다.
이 가이드에서는 다음을 살펴보겠습니다. 최고의 AI 테스트 도구개발 파이프라인에 맞는 솔루션을 선택하는 데 도움이 되는 뛰어난 기능, 사용 사례 및 이점을 소개합니다. 💼🔍
💡 AI 테스트 도구란 무엇인가?
AI 테스트 도구 인공 지능과 머신 러닝 알고리즘을 사용하여 테스트 케이스 생성, 회귀 테스트, 버그 감지, 성능 모니터링 및 예측 분석과 같은 소프트웨어 테스트 작업을 자동화합니다. 이러한 도구는 팀이 다음을 수행하는 데 도움이 됩니다. 🔹 결함을 조기에 감지
🔹 테스트 범위 개선
🔹 거짓 양성을 최소화하세요
🔹 출시 주기를 가속화하세요
🚀 최고의 AI 테스트 도구
1. Tricentis의 Testim
🔹 특징: 🔹 AI 기반 테스트 케이스 생성 및 유지 관리
🔹 자체 복구 테스트 자동화
🔹 엔드투엔드 웹 및 모바일 테스트
🔹 이익: ✅ 테스트의 불안정성과 유지 관리 오버헤드를 줄입니다.
✅ CI/CD 파이프라인과의 쉬운 통합
✅ Agile 및 DevOps 환경에 적합
🔗 더 읽어보기
2. 앱리툴스
🔹 특징: 🔹 스마트 이미지 비교를 통한 시각적 AI 테스트
🔹 다양한 기기와 브라우저에서 자동화된 UI 검증
🔹 병렬 실행을 위한 초고속 그리드
🔹 이익: ✅ 기존 테스트에서 놓친 시각적 버그를 감지합니다.
✅ Selenium, Cypress 등을 지원합니다
✅ 사용자 경험 보장을 강화합니다
🔗 더 읽어보기
3. 마블
🔹 특징: 🔹 머신 러닝을 통한 지능형 테스트 자동화
🔹 자체 복구 테스트 및 로우코드 테스트 생성
🔹 성능 모니터링 및 진단
🔹 이익: ✅ 회귀 테스트를 가속화합니다
✅ 교차 기능 팀에 이상적
✅ 테스트 결과에 대한 실시간 통찰력
🔗 더 읽어보기
4. 기능화하다
🔹 특징: 🔹 자연어를 사용한 AI 기반 테스트 생성
🔹 자율 테스트 실행 및 스마트 유지 관리
🔹 클라우드 기반 테스트 환경
🔹 이익: ✅ 테스트는 애플리케이션 변경 사항에 자동으로 적응됩니다.
✅ 비기술 사용자에게도 쉽습니다.
✅ 테스트 범위를 확장하는 팀에 적합합니다.
🔗 더 읽어보기
5. TestCraft(현재 Perforce의 일부)
🔹 특징: 🔹 코드리스 AI 테스트 자동화
🔹 실시간 버그 감지
🔹 지속적인 테스트 통합
🔹 이익: ✅ 코딩 없이 빠른 테스트 배포
✅ QA 주기를 단축합니다
✅ 동적 UI 테스트에 강력함
🔗 더 읽어보기
📊 비교표 – 최고의 AI 테스트 도구
도구 | 주요 초점 영역 | 가장 좋은 | 독특한 특징 |
---|---|---|---|
테스팀 | 자체 복구 자동화 | Agile 및 DevOps 팀 | 적응형 테스트 유지 관리 |
앱리툴스 | 시각적 UI 테스트 | 크로스 브라우저 호환성 | Visual AI 비교 엔진 |
마블 | 성능 및 회귀 | 제품 및 QA 팀 | 로우코드 자동화 + 분석 |
기능화하다 | NLP 테스트 생성 | 비기술 QA 테스터 | 자연어 인터페이스 |
테스트크래프트 | 코드리스 UI 자동화 | 빠르게 성장하는 QA 팀 | 시각적 테스트 모델링 |
🧠 AI 테스트 도구를 사용해야 하는 이유
🔹 더 빠른 출시 시간: 복잡한 테스트 모음을 자동화하고 릴리스 주기를 가속화합니다.
🔹 더욱 스마트한 버그 감지: 예측 분석을 사용하여 문제를 조기에 식별
🔹 유지 관리 감소: AI는 변화에 적응하여 테스트 스크립트 업데이트를 줄입니다.
🔹 더 높은 정확도: 거짓 양성을 최소화하고 적용 범위를 극대화합니다.
🔹 더 나은 협업: 비기술 사용자가 테스트에 참여할 수 있도록 지원